Choices
Clinton John Mattingly 1975 (Utah)
If you want to know sorrow,
and you want to feel pain.
Pick up an addiction,
and throw your life down the drain.
I speak from experience,
that's no lie.
i know if i continue,
I'm guaranteed to die.
But yet death is not the road,
i choose to travel.
For i have a beautiful future,
I've yet to unravel.
Free from addictions,
and full of love.
If I can just follow the teachings,
from the man up above.
Which I know I can do,
by staying true to my heart.
fighting he who would love nothing,
But to tear me apart.
See your not alone,
in this tremendous fight.
You'll always have Me and the Lord,
to help you set things right.
So don't be afraid,
to take the first step.
Cause you can trust and believe,
we'll show you what's next.
by Clinton Mattingly
